Rasha Thadani recently turned heads with a soothing series of photos shared on her Instagram feed, where she embraced nature and spirituality — dressed in a pink and green outfit that made her look effortlessly
radiant.
The images feature Rasha at the Lakshman Temple, located on the banks of the Parameshwar Tal (lake) in Chanderi, Madhya Pradesh. Rasha posted the photos, which show her against verdant natural settings and the temple area, creating a calm, dreamy atmosphere. She used two emoticons of a peacock and a heart as the caption.

The carousel of images begins with Rasha sitting on a hilly staircase, followed by her exploring temples, posing in front of the Lakshman Temple and under a tree. She also shared an image of a Shivling and more images of her against the backdrop of verdant greenery.

Rasha Thadani’s Spiritual Journey
Rasha and her mother, seasoned actress Raveena Tandon, earlier embarked on a broader spiritual journey that aligns with this elegant and tranquil outing. The mother-daughter duo fulfilled a long-standing commitment to visit all 12 holy sites by completing their journey to the 12th and final Nageshwar Jyotirlinga temple in Gujarat.
Rasha said in an interview that the black threads, or kala dhagas, she wears are from the Jyotirlingas she has visited. Rasha also revealed that, at the age of 19, she had already been to 11 Jyotirlingas, or shrines honouring Lord Shiva. She only wanted to visit the 12th one this year.
She eventually fulfilled her wish of visiting the 12th Jyotirling, two weeks after her debut film ‘Azaad’ hit the theatres. “Nageshwar, my 12th Jyotirling, and Dwarkadhish. Feeling blessed and thankful. Har Har Mahadev,” Rasha wrote in the caption.

Rasha Thadani on the Work Front
Rasha Thadani made her Bollywood debut as Janaki Bahadur in the 2025 film ‘Azaad,’ co-starring with Ajay Devgn’s nephew Aaman Devgan. where the song “Uyi Amma” won her applause. By choosing a movie with a historical and dramatic plot, she avoided a flashy “glam debut” and expressed her desire to be acknowledged as an actress rather than as a star-kid.
Beyond acting, Rasha is also cultivating a multi-faceted artistic persona: she’s trained in music (through a reputed academy), practices martial arts (holds a black belt in Taekwondo), and pursues wildlife photography — interests that suggest she aims for versatility rather than being pigeonholed as a typical debutante.
